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Carpentarian dunnart | Leaf Beetle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Dasyuromorphia (Dasyuromorphia) | Coleoptera (Beetles) |
| Family | Dasyuridae | Chrysomelidae |
| Genus | Sminthopsis | Galerucella |
| Species | Sminthopsis butleri | Galerucella nymphaeae |
